CDKA PLC hydraulic counterblow hammer
Regarding CHK PLC fully-hydraulic die forging hammer, Its framework weight is quite heavy and the investment of equipment, anti-vibration foundation and transportation is relativelyhigher. Therefore we suggest you choose counterblow hammer without anvil for large forginghammer with striking energy more than 100KJ.
Just as the name implied, the counterblow hammer is a kind of hammer that the upper tup and the lower tup strike each other with equal energy.
In the early 70s Baixie has collaborated with Taiyuan Heavy-duty Machinery College to developthe first set 63kJ hydraulic counterblow hammer in China. And in the 80s Baixie introducedtechnology of 100KJ hydraulic counterblow hammer from China Jinan Foundry andMetalforming Machinery Research Institute.
On the basis of CHK PLC fully-hydraulic die forging hammer, Baixie absorbed theadvanced technique of large forging hammer from home and abroad.CDKA PLC hydraulic counterblow hammer adopts unique and up-to-date design, welding structure framework , counterblow system with equal weight and equal stroke ,advanced hydraulic drivingsystem and PLC strike control system with man-machine interface.
Structure characteristics:
CDKA PLC hydraulic counterblow hammers counterblow system adopts welding framework, adjustable actinoid wide guide construction, which is especially suitable for precisionforging. The clearance of guide rail can accurate to 0.2 mm. The upper and lower hammertup relatively move with equal stroke and equal energy in the frame.
The weight ratio of upper and lower hammer tup is 1:1, linkage by a set of oil cylindercoupling in the frame. It realized counterblow in the midair under the drive of hydraulic system.
CDKA PLC hydraulic counterblow hammers hydraulic system was installed on theframework with elastic antivibration pad.
The hydraulic system adopts advanced taper cone valve control technic, combination cylinder transmission technology, double anti-leak technic and hydraulic integration technic to realize fewer pipe connection of main oil circuit. So the system structure is greatly simple.
CDKA PLC hydraulic counterblow hammers striking control system can realize man-machine conversation and display the working statues and malfunctions through the touch screen as well as control the striking energy and striking programable through PLC
Performance and feature
A. High energy-saving
CDKA PLC hydraulic counterblow hammer is actuated by hydraulic drive system, which makes the energy utilization to 65% and the striking efficiency up to 95%.However, traditional forging hammer only has 2-3% energy utilization and 85% striking frequency. Furthermore, the energy-saving is precisely on controlling striking energy and it is wasteful to give more.
B. high accuracy
CDKA PLC hydraulic counterblow hammer adopts higher rigid welding framework andadjustable actinoid wide guide, which are the indispensable condition for accurate forging; theprecise control of striking energy and the realization of programmingstriking can avoid the unstable quality due to different operator.
